Event description

Employee killed in excavation cave-in

Investigation abstract

At approximately 10:10 a.m. on May 20, 1988, Employee #1 was removing soil from an approximately 40 by 30 foot excavation. An approximately 10 foot section of t he west wall collapsed, burying and killing him.
